2. Ravi purchased an old house for Rs. 76.5000 and
spent Rs. 115000 on its. Then he sold it at a
gain of 5%. How many
much did he get.​

Respuesta :

MollieToliver MollieToliver
  • 08-08-2020

Answer:

Rs. 924000.

Step-by-step explanation:

Cost of  house = 765000

Additional money spent on it = 115000

Total cost incurred by Ravi = 765000 + 115000 = 880000

Gain  = 5% of total cost

gain in Rs = 5/100 * 880000 = Rs. 44000

Total selling price of house = total cost incurred + profit = 880000+ 44000

Total selling price of house = Rs. 924000

Thus, Ravi got  Rs. 924000.
